"subversive" in Chinese (Traditional)
顛覆性的破壞性的
Definition
試圖削弱或推翻現有體制、權威或機構,通常以隱蔽或激進的方式進行。
Usage Notes (Chinese (Traditional))
多用於正式、學術或政治語境,通常形容被視為對權威或秩序有威脅的行為、思想或人。常與「活動」「團體」等詞搭配。褒貶視角度而定。
Examples
The government arrested several subversive leaders.
政府逮捕了幾名**顛覆性**分子。
The film was banned for its subversive message.
這部電影因其**顛覆性**訊息被禁播。
She wrote a subversive article criticizing the system.
她寫了一篇**顛覆性**的文章批評體制。
His art is considered subversive because it challenges social norms.
他的藝術被認為很**顛覆性**,因為它挑戰社會規範。
They accused the group of subversive activities against the government.
他們指控該團體從事反政府的**顛覆性**活動。
Some see her ideas as subversive, while others call them inspiring.
有些人認為她的觀點很**顛覆性**,而另一些人覺得很鼓舞人心。
